WebStart with a clean, dry coat and a warm (hot) day. Place coat in the sunshine for several minutes to allow it to heat up so it feels warm and supple to the touch. Do not leave unattended for extended period as with many fabrics, extended exposure to sunlight will sun-bleach the fabric. Warm up the Duck Back dressing by putting the jar in the ...
